Summary

On 27 October 2018 at about 20:45 local time, a Agusta AGUSTA AW169 registered G-VSKP was involved in an accident near Leicester, United Kingdom. 5 people were on board and 5 died. The aircraft was destroyed. No probable cause statement is available for this record.

Read the full NTSB narrative

The United Kingdom's Air Accidents Investigation Branch (AAIB) has notified the NTSB of an accident involving an Agusta AW169, which occurred on October 27, 2018. The NTSB has appointed a U.S. Accredited Representative to assist the AAIB investigation under the provisions of ICAO Annex 13 as the State of Manufacturer and Design of airplane components. All investigative information will be released by the AAIB.
